Understanding the Science of Weight Loss
Before we dive to the tips, you need to understand the science behind weight loss. When you eat more calories than you burn, your body stores excess energy as fat. To lose weight, you'll want to create a calorie deficit when you eat fewer calories or burning more calories through exercise and exercising.

Top Tips to Lose Weight Fast


1. Create a Calorie Deficit: Aim for a regular calorie deficit of 500-1000 calories to promote weight loss while still providing your system with enough energy.
2. Eat Protein-Rich Foods: Protein takes more energy to digest, which will help increase your metabolic process reduce hunger. Aim for 1.6-2.2 grams of protein per kilogram of bodyweight.
3. Incorporate HIIT Workouts: High-Intensity Interval Training (HIIT) training is effective for burning calories and muscle building. Aim for 15-20 minutes of HIIT exercises every day.
4. Drink Plenty of Water: Staying hydrated might help boost your metabolic process and reduce appetite. Aim for at least 8 cups (64 ounces) of water per day.
5. Get Enough Sleep: Poor sleep can disrupt hormones that regulate hunger and fullness, leading to weight gain. Aim for 7-9 hours of sleep per night.
6. Eat Fiber-Rich Foods: Fiber might help reduce hunger and increase satiety. Aim for 25-30 grams of fiber each day from foods like fruits, vegetables, and cereals.
7. Reduce Sugar Intake: Consuming high levels of sugar can cause insulin resistance and fat gain. Aim for no more than 25 grams of sugar per day.
8. Incorporate Strength Training: Building muscle through weight training can help raise your metabolism and use up more calories at rest.
9. Eat More Healthy Fats: Healthy fats like avocado, nuts, and olive oil may help reduce hunger and increase satiety.
10. Monitor Your Progress: Tracking your progress may help you stay motivated and earn adjustments to what you eat and exercise plan if required.

Additional Tips for Sustainable Weight Loss

1. Focus on Whole Foods: Focus on whole, unprocessed foods like fruits, vegetables, whole grains, lean proteins, and healthy fats.
2. Be Patient: Losing weight quickly may not be healthy or sustainable. Aim for a gradual fat loss of 0.5-1 kg weekly.
3. Avoid Fad Diets: Fad diets could be restrictive and may not provide adequate nutrition. Focus on making sustainable changes in lifestyle instead.
4. Get Support: Having a support system will help you stay motivated and accountable on your weight-loss journey.
